Sunny Day at Lords by Ernest Wallcousins
This image shows an enthusiastic crowd watching a cricket match. Painted in 1926 the grand stand can be seen in the distance, which had just been built

This evocative image, titled "Sunny Day at Lord's" by renowned British painter Ernest Wallcousins, captures the excitement and energy of a cricket match in progress at the iconic Lord's Cricket Ground in London during the summer of 1926. The painting, which measures 21 x 15 inches, is a vibrant and detailed depiction of the crowd's enthusiasm as they watch intently, some leaning forward in their seats, others standing and cheering, all absorbed in the thrill of the game. The historical significance of this painting lies in the fact that the grand stand in the distance, which had just been built, can be clearly seen. This grandstand, a testament to the enduring popularity of cricket, adds to the sense of tradition and nostalgia that permeates the scene. The image, which was painted in oil on canvas, is a testament to Wallcousins' skill as an artist, with his expert use of light and color to bring the scene to life. The painting, which is dated 12th June 1926, is a precious piece of cricket history and a reminder of the passion and dedication that cricket fans have for the sport. The image, which is part of the Illustrated London News archive, is a valuable addition to any collection of cricket memorabilia or historical art.
